When people talk about “out-of-state” in Auburn recruitment discussions, they’re often using the term more broadly than its literal meaning. It includes true out-of-state students, but it can also refer to girls from small rural Alabama towns who don’t come from the traditional recruitment pipelines. It may even include girls from the major pipeline schools who are intentionally looking outside the usual houses their classmates and older friends join.
By contrast, “in-state” in recruitment conversations is referring to the established pipeline system, primarily girls from the large private and well-connected public schools in Birmingham, Montgomery, and Mobile that have long-standing relationships, family connections, and recruitment networks within many chapters.
Obviously there are exceptions, and every chapter takes members from all backgrounds. But when people discuss recruitment trends, they’re usually referring less to a girl’s actual state of residence and more to whether she comes from one of the traditional recruitment pipelines or from outside that system.
